What Are The Unique Requirements for Detergents in Commercial Dishwashing?

The unique requirements for detergents in commercial dishwashing include effectiveness in high-temperature environments, quick rinsing capabilities, low-foaming properties, and compatibility with various water types.

  1. High-temperature effectiveness
  2. Quick rinsing capabilities
  3. Low-foaming properties
  4. Compatibility with hard and soft water
  5. Environmental safety considerations

High-temperature effectiveness: High-temperature effectiveness is crucial for commercial dishwashing detergents, as they must perform optimally in high heat environments. Commercial dishwashers often operate at temperatures ranging from 140°F to 180°F (60°C to 82°C). Studies show that temperatures above 160°F (71°C) enhance grease and soil removal efficiency. The U.S. Environmental Protection Agency emphasizes that detergents used at these temperatures should effectively break down food residues, ensuring hygienic results.

Quick rinsing capabilities: Quick rinsing capabilities allow detergents to be easily washed away without leaving residues on dishes. Commercial settings require rapid turnaround times, and any leftover detergent can impact the taste and safety of food. Research indicates that some formulations reduce drying times and improve overall sanitation levels, highlighting the importance of this attribute. According to a case study by the Food Service Technology Center, effective quick rinsing helps maintain inventory turnover in busy food establishments.

Low-foaming properties: Low-foaming properties are essential for commercial dishwashing detergents to prevent excessive suds that can hinder cleaning performance and machine efficiency. Excess foam can lead to malfunctioning of the dishwashing machines. The National Sanitation Foundation notes that the ideal detergent should create minimal foam while still ensuring maximum cleaning power. For instance, formulas designed specifically for high-efficiency machines often include this attribute.

Compatibility with hard and soft water: Compatibility with hard and soft water ensures that detergents work effectively across various water types. Hard water contains high mineral content, which can interfere with cleaning efficiency. Detergents that demonstrate adaptability can achieve consistent results, regardless of water quality. The International Association for Food Protection mentions that products that include chelating agents can help in softening hard water, thereby improving cleaning action.

Environmental safety considerations: Environmental safety is increasingly important in selecting commercial dishwashing detergents. Many establishments seek biodegradable products or those with reduced environmental impact to comply with green initiatives. Research conducted by the Sustainable Food Service Coalition outlines that environmentally friendly detergents can perform effectively while reducing harmful discharges into waterways. Many businesses are shifting towards safer cleaning supplies, showcasing a growing preference for sustainable practices in commercial dishwashing.

What Key Ingredients Should You Look for in Effective Commercial Dishwasher Detergents?

Key ingredients to look for in effective commercial dishwasher detergents include enzymes, surfactants, alkaline agents, and sanitizers.

  1. Enzymes
  2. Surfactants
  3. Alkaline agents
  4. Sanitizers

The effectiveness of these ingredients can depend on various factors, including water hardness and the types of soil present on the dishware.

  1. Enzymes:
    Enzymes in commercial dishwasher detergents enhance cleaning efficiency by breaking down specific types of soil such as proteins and starches. They work at lower temperatures, which saves energy. Protease enzymes target protein-rich residues, while amylase enzymes focus on starches. According to a study by D. C. Schmitt (2021), using enzyme-based detergents can reduce cleaning times significantly. For example, a restaurant using enzyme detergents reported a 30% decrease in cycle time while maintaining cleanliness standards.

  2. Surfactants:
    Surfactants reduce surface tension and enhance the wetting properties of the detergent. They help water to spread and penetrate food soils, making it easier to remove residue. Nonionic, anionic, and cationic surfactants serve different purposes. For example, nonionic surfactants are effective against greasy residues, while anionic ones work better in hard water. The US Environmental Protection Agency (EPA) has noted that selecting the right surfactant can lead to improved cleaning results and less environmental impact.

  3. Alkaline agents:
    Alkaline agents, such as sodium hydroxide or sodium carbonate, raise the pH of the wash water. This change helps in emulsifying fats and dissolving mineral deposits. Higher pH levels allow for better grease removal and improve the effectiveness of surfactants. A report by the Center for Clean Water (2020) suggested that alkaline detergents are particularly effective in environments with hard water, as they help prevent limescale buildup in dishwashers.

  4. Sanitizers:
    Sanitizers eliminate bacteria and pathogens that might remain on dishware after washing. Common sanitizing agents include chlorine and quaternary ammonium compounds. These ingredients not only ensure cleanliness but also comply with health regulations in food service establishments. A study by the National Sanitation Foundation (2020) highlighted that using sanitizing detergents reduced instances of cross-contamination in commercial kitchens, leading to safer food handling.

Why Is It Important to Select the Right Detergent for Different Water Conditions?

Selecting the right detergent for different water conditions is crucial for optimal cleaning and efficiency. Detergents perform differently based on water hardness, temperature, and pH levels. Using a suitable detergent ensures effective removal of soil and stains, while also protecting surfaces and equipment.

According to the American Cleaning Institute, detergent is defined as a substance that cleans by removing dirt and grease through chemical action. Different water conditions impact the effectiveness of detergents and their ability to interact with soil.

The underlying reasons for carefully selecting detergents relate to the chemical interactions between water, detergent, and the soils. Hard water contains high levels of minerals such as calcium and magnesium. These minerals can bind with detergent molecules, reducing their cleaning power. Detergents formulated for hard water often contain chelating agents, which bind to these minerals and enhance cleaning efficiency.

A key technical term is ‘surfactant.’ Surfactants are substances that lower the surface tension of water, allowing it to spread and penetrate soils effectively. In hard water, surfactants can become less effective due to mineral binding. Therefore, specific formulas are designed to function well in hard versus soft water conditions.

Effective detergents often involve mechanisms such as emulsification and soil suspension. Emulsification breaks down grease and oils, while soil suspension keeps dirt particles suspended in water to prevent redeposition on cleaned surfaces. For example, in hard water conditions, a detergent with strong emulsifying agents may be necessary to address tougher soil without losing effectiveness.

Specific water conditions that can contribute to detergent performance issues include high mineral content in hard water or low temperatures that affect solubility. For instance, using a regular detergent in hard water may leave residues on dishes, while using a specialized hard water detergent can result in a cleaner finish. Likewise, cold water temperatures may require detergents that are designed to work efficiently in cooler conditions to ensure effective cleaning.

How Do You Properly Use and Measure Detergents in Commercial Dishwashers?

To properly use and measure detergents in commercial dishwashers, follow the manufacturer’s guidelines, calibrate the detergent dispenser, and regularly monitor wash results.

Following the manufacturer’s guidelines ensures that the right type and amount of detergent is used. Manufacturers usually provide specific instructions tailored to their machines. These guidelines cover critical aspects such as:

  • Detergent type: Use only detergents designed for commercial dishwashers. These detergents are formulated to work effectively with high temperatures and are usually more concentrated than household versions.
  • Proper doses: Follow the recommended dosage per load. This dosage may vary based on the machine and the detergent brand, affecting cleaning efficiency and cost.

Calibrating the detergent dispenser ensures that it delivers the correct amount of detergent consistently. For effective calibration:

  • Consult the manual: Refer to the dishwasher’s manual for specific calibration instructions and settings.
  • Regular adjustments: After calibration, periodically check the settings, especially after changing detergent brands or types, as they can differ in concentration and effectiveness.

Regularly monitoring wash results is crucial for maintaining wash quality. This can involve:

  • Visual inspections: Examine the dishes after washing for food residue, cloudiness, or streaks. Insufficient cleaning indicates a problem with detergent dosing or selection.
  • Performance checks: Run tests, such as inspecting glassware for spots or stains, to determine if the washing cycle meets hygiene and presentation standards.

Maintaining water temperature is also essential for optimal detergent performance. Most commercial dishwashers operate effectively at temperatures ranging from 140°F to 180°F (60°C to 82°C). Hot water enhances the detergents’ ability to emulsify oils and suspend soil.

Additionally, consider water hardness. Hard water can inhibit detergent performance, leading to scaling and reduced cleaning efficiency. Using a water softener can help maintain optimal operational conditions.

By applying these guidelines, commercial dishwashers can achieve efficient cleaning results while maximizing detergent effectiveness.

What Safety Guidelines Should You Follow When Handling Dishwasher Detergents?

When handling dishwasher detergents, it is essential to follow specific safety guidelines to prevent accidents and ensure safe usage.

  1. Read and follow label instructions
  2. Keep detergents out of reach of children
  3. Avoid mixing different detergents
  4. Wear protective gear
  5. Store in a cool, dry place
  6. Use in well-ventilated areas
  7. Rinse hands after handling
  8. In case of contact, seek medical advice

Now, let’s delve deeper into each safety guideline.

  1. Reading and Following Label Instructions: Reading and following label instructions is crucial for safe use of dishwasher detergents. Labels contain important information regarding usage, dilution ratios, and safety precautions. Misunderstanding or ignoring these instructions can lead to improper use, resulting in damage to dishes or potential harm to users.

  2. Keeping Detergents Out of Reach of Children: Keeping detergents out of reach of children is essential to prevent accidental ingestion or exposure. Many dishwasher detergents contain harmful chemicals that can cause serious health issues if ingested. According to the American Association of Poison Control Centers, hundreds of children experience poisoning from household cleaners each year.

  3. Avoiding Mixing Different Detergents: Avoiding mixing different detergents is important to prevent chemical reactions. Combining various cleaning agents can create toxic fumes or reduce the effectiveness of the products. For instance, mixing bleach with ammonia leads to the release of harmful chloramine vapors, posing serious health risks.

  4. Wearing Protective Gear: Wearing protective gear can significantly reduce the risk of injury when handling dishwasher detergents. Clothing such as rubber gloves and goggles protect skin and eyes from chemical splashes. The National Institute for Occupational Safety and Health recommends using personal protective equipment (PPE) when dealing with hazardous materials.

  5. Storing in a Cool, Dry Place: Storing detergent in a cool, dry place helps maintain its integrity and effectiveness. High humidity or temperature can cause degradation of the product. The product’s effectiveness can decline, which ultimately leads to less satisfactory cleaning results.

  6. Using in Well-Ventilated Areas: Using detergents in well-ventilated areas is vital for reducing inhalation exposure. Many dishwasher detergents emit fumes that can irritate the respiratory system. The Occupational Safety and Health Administration (OSHA) emphasizes the importance of sufficient ventilation when using chemical cleaners.

  7. Rinsing Hands After Handling: Rinsing hands after handling detergents is necessary to prevent skin irritation and potential allergic reactions. Many dishwasher detergents contain surfactants and fragrances that can lead to skin problems upon prolonged exposure.

  8. In Case of Contact, Seeking Medical Advice: In case of contact with skin or eyes, seeking medical advice immediately is crucial. Many dishwasher detergents can cause burns or irritation, and prompt medical attention can mitigate serious harm. The American Chemical Society recommends following emergency instructions on the label in case of such incidents.
